Lupus & Brain Fog: When Your Mind Gets Misty for No Reason at All
Living with lupus means navigating symptoms that don’t always make sense to other people and sometimes don’t make sense to you either. One of the most confusing (and most common) is brain fog: that hazy, slow, glitchy feeling where your thoughts don’t quite connect the way they normally do.
